What is milliliter?

A milliliter (abbreviated as "ml" or "mL") is a unit of volume in the metric system, equal to one-thousandth of a liter or 0.001 liters. It is commonly used to measure liquids in cooking, science, and medicine. [Source: Wikipedia]
